Setting the Stage | Natasha Davison, Emory

Keynotes - August 31, 2021 13:00 - 27 minutes ★★★★★ - 1 rating
As a young girl, Natasha Davison dreamt of Broadway. As an adult, she’s an award-winning producer of Broadway shows, including the Tony-nominated show “The Prom.” Tune in and learn about Natasha’s pursuit of equal, true and vibrant representation of women in her work.

Monmouth Origins

Voyage of Discovery - October 13, 2019 19:04 - 13 minutes ★★★★★ - 4 ratings
It may seem odd that Monmouth, IL, is the birthplace of two women's fraternities, but conditions in the Midwest were ideal for the development of these organizations. Learn about the beginning of Kappa Kappa Gamma in Voyage of Discovery's inaugural episode.
